So, which bones are referred to as metatarsals? If you guessed bones of the foot, you hit the nail on the head! Our metatarsals are those five long bones located right between the tarsal bones and the phalanges, which are the toe bones. Specifically, they stretch from the midfoot up to those little toes that help us dance, walk, or just keep our balance when we’re a bit off-kilter.

Believe it or not, the metatarsals are numbered one to five, starting with the big toe. That’s right—the first is closest to that big toe, and the fifth is way on the outside, just next to the little toe. Each one provides critical support to the arches of the foot. The primary function of metatarsals revolves around weight-bearing and force distribution. Imagine trying to walk without them! Their length and structure enable our incredible feet to absorb shock as we move, whether we’re strolling through a park or sprinting to catch a bus. These bones act as a sort of shock absorber, allowing us to enjoy movement dynamically and efficiently.
